In the long arc of survival horror's evolution, Capcom appears poised to revisit one of its most storied chapters — the island prison of Rockfort — not as a faithful recreation, but as an expanded reimagining that grants players open space to breathe and a villain long overdue for his proper reckoning. Leaked details from a trusted insider suggest the Code Veronica remake is quietly advancing ahead of its sibling project, Resident Evil 0, while the franchise simultaneously prepares a confirmed new entry set against the ruins of Raccoon City.
